Not at all. This program does not require any prior experience with horses. We always put safety first and each program begins with an orientation that includes safety and interpreting the many ways horses communicate.

In Equine-Assisted Learning (EAL) horses are valued partners and guides. They offer immediate feedback through their responses to participants’ actions and emotions, aiding in the development of essential life skills such as communication, leadership, and problem-solving. Horses naturally assist in the process, supporting individuals in exploring personal goals and challenges, and fostering self-awareness, emotional regulation, and confidence. Overall, horses play a crucial role in guiding participants on journeys of learning, self-awareness, and personal development through their remarkable sensitivity and non-verbal communication skills.

For safety, simple things like closed toe shoes. Also, dress in clothes suitable for the outside temperature (our facility is heated, but can still remain cool during the winter) and that you are ok if it gets a little dusty or dirty.

For public group youth programs, you’re free to drop off and pick up or wait in our loft area that overlooks the arena. For private bookings and larger groups, we may require adult(s) to accompany based on the needs and size of the group.

No. All of our activities are non-mounted. The horses are a part of your team and you will work alongside them to connect with a new style of communication. This way the horse can be their true self and you can be your true self.

In an Equine-Assisted Learning (EAL) session, participation is experiential and hands-on. Upon arrival, you’ll be welcomed into a safe, welcoming space where you will meet your facilitators and equine partners. Throughout the session, you’ll engage in activities that are designed to foster personal growth, communication, and emotional resilience. These may include guided interactions with the horses, such as leading, grooming, or navigating obstacles, which provide immediate, non-verbal feedback from the horses. You’ll be encouraged to reflect on your experience and share your thoughts and feelings with your facilitator, who will help you process any insights gained during the session. The focus is on moving at your own pace, with no pressure, in a supportive and non-judgmental environment. By participating in these hands-on activities and reflecting on your interactions with the horses, you’ll discover new ways to develop self-awareness, build confidence, and enhance life skills.
